Mike Hauri
Lead Brass & Woodwind
Technician
Mike is a 2006 band instrument repair program graduate at Minnesota State College, Red Wing, MN. Mike specializes in brass and woodwind repairs and has worked at Voigt Music Center since 2013 and is our Service Manager.
His primary instrument is the saxophone, and his main interest is in vintage saxophones from the 1920s through the 1950s. Mike has worked at an overhaul shop and another major music retailer from the Milwaukee market, where he was known as "Mr. Saxophone."
Mike was a saxophonist in the jazz/rock combo Good Question and a former powerlifter. Mike is an Elite-Level, nationally recognized championship archer in his free time and enjoys hunting with his chocolate labs, Penny and Cooper.
Brad Karas
Orchestral & Fretted
Technician
Brad specializes in orchestral and fretted string instrument repairs and has a passion for working with performers; ensuring their instrument is best setup to suit their individual style of playing. Like musicians, every string instrument is an individual that needs something a little different. Whether it’s working with performers and professions or maintaining student instruments, Brad’s attention to detail and pursuit of excellence drives him in his craft.
Brad has a Bachelor of Arts in Music Performance and Jazz Studies from UW-Parkside and has been an active performer and teacher for over 20 years. This experience aides in identifying what an instrument needs to be the best it can be. Outside of music, Brad enjoys spending time with his family, reading, and riding his motorcycle.
Mike Pollock
Brass Technician
Specialist
Mike is a brass repair specialist and instrument repair technician who has been working professionally in the field since May 2024. He holds a Bachelor of Music in Music Education with an emphasis in Euphonium Pedagogy from UW Stevens Point. He also completed programs in violin repair and band instrument repair at Minnesota State College Southeast in Red Wing, MN.
With primary performance experience through euphonium, tuba, and trombone, he brings a deep understanding of how instruments should feel and respond in the hands of players. After eight years of teaching students, Mike chose to return to school to pursue repair full-time. His interest in repair stems from his lesson teacher growing up who had a passion for the trade.
Outside the shop, he enjoys playing Dungeons & Dragons and spending time with friends and family.
Molly Brehm
Woodwind Technician
Specialist
Molly Brehm started at Voigt Music Center in the summer of 2023. She is a graduate of Minnesota State College Southeast with a diploma in Band Instrument Repair. She is in her 3rd year of instrument repair and focuses primarily on woodwind instruments. Molly is detail oriented in her work to ensure your instrument is playing smoothly and sounding exactly as it should.
As a performer, Molly has been playing flute for 8 years & the clarinet for 3 . Her performance experience aids her in identifying problems and ensuring the precision of her repairs when playtesting an instrument. Outside of the world of music Molly enjoys spending time outdoors going hiking, kayaking and camping.
